The largest growth market in the nation, Texas adds hundreds of thousands of new residents annually, with corporate relocations to Dallas-Fort Worth and Austin driving an unprecedented construction and home services boom.

Extreme summer heat over 100F shifts outdoor work schedules, while Gulf Coast hurricanes, North Texas hailstorms, and Hill Country flash floods create region-specific surges in emergency service demand year-round.

HVAC lead costs in Texas vary by service type. Emergency repair leads typically run $35-$75, while full system replacement leads range $80-$200, reflecting their much higher job value.
